Webv. Armstrong, 223 Wis. 2d 331, 588 N.W.2d 606 (1999), which held that an incarcerated person is per se in custody for purposes of Miranda. The State, however, contends that a subsequent United States Supreme Court case, Howes v. Fields, 565 U.S. 499 (2012), effectively overruled Armstrong’s per se custody rule. WebFields was arrested for disorderly conduct. While he was serving his jail sentence, police separated Fields from the general jail population, and questioned him for seven hours about possible sex crimes with a minor. Fields was never given Miranda warnings, but was told he did not have to cooperate if he so chose.

The case is about an inmate´s confession … Web21 feb. 2012 · Summary Police questioning of a prison inmate about misconduct occurring prior to incarceration, alone, does not constitute “custodial” for Miranda purposes. While serving a sentence in jail, Fields was questioned about alleged sexual conduct with a minor. He was not first advised of his Miranda rights.

WebHowes v. Fields • Summarize the background of Howes v. Fields and the court decision. This case is about Fields, a state prisoner, that is taken from his cell to a well lite conference room. Fields is then told that at any time he was free to go back to cell. Fields was questioned for several hours about the crimes that he allegedly committed.

WebThe court emphasized that Fields was told that he was free to leave and return to his cell but that he never asked to do so. The Michigan Supreme Court denied discretionary review. Fields then filed a petition for a writ of habeas corpus in Federal District Court, and …
